/* -----------------------------------------------------------------
input: a word (a string of ascii character terminated by NULL)
output: a hash_value of the input word.
hash function: if the word has length <= 4
        the hash value is just a concatenation of the last four bits
        of the characters.
        if the word has length > 4, then after the above operation,
        the hash value is updated by adding each remaining character.
        (and AND with the 16-bits mask).
---------------------------------------------------------------- */
int
thash64k(word, len)
unsigned char *word;
int len;
{
    unsigned int hash_value=0;
    unsigned int mask_4=017;
    unsigned int mask_16=0177777;
    int i;

    if(len<=4) {
        for(i=0; i<len; i++) {
            hash_value = (hash_value << 4) | (word[i]&mask_4);
            /* hash_value = hash_value  & mask_16; */
        }
    }
    else {
        for(i=0; i<4; i++) {
            hash_value = (hash_value << 4) | (word[i]&mask_4);
            /* hash_value = hash_value & mask_16;  */
        }
        for(i=4; i<len; i++)
            hash_value = mask_16 & (hash_value + word[i]);
    }
    return(hash_value & mask_16);
}

/*
 * HASHFILE format: the hash-file is a sequence of "'\0' hash-index word-index word-name"
 * The '\0' is there to indicate that this is not a padded line. Padded lines simply have
 * a '\n' as the first character (words don't have '\0' or '\n'). The hash and word indices
 * are 2 unsigned short integers in binary, MSB first. The word name therefore starts from the
 * 5th character and continues until a '\0' or '\n' is encountered. The total size of the
 * hash-table is therefore (|avgwordlen|+5)*numwords = appx 12 * 50000 = .6MB.
 * Note that there can be multiple lines with the same hash-index.
 */
